Abstract

Human Geography in Beijing University is the key subject of nation-leveled higher learning ratified by Chinese national educational committee. Nowdays it has three majors which are Economic Geography and Urban Planning, Real estate Development and Tourism Development and Management. It also has a Historical Geography Research Room and the Center of Urban Planning and Designing. Every year it recruits more than ten master's graduate students and about six doctoral graduate students majored in Human Geography. A post-doctorate mobile station is also established.
Persons who do Human Geography research and teaching have the characteristics of high quantity and quality. All of them have different speciality and have made some contributions in related fields.
Directors of doctoral graduate students are:Hou Ren-Zhi (Academician, Historical Geography and Beijing's Historical Geography), Yang Wu-Yang (Geographical History and Theoritical geography), Zhou Yi-Xing (Urban Research), Xie Ning-Gao (Scenic Region), Yu Xi-xian (Historical Geography). Professors are:Wei Xin-Zhen (Industrial Geography, Land Planning), Dong Li-Ming (Urban Planning, Classification and Evaluation of Urban Land), Zhu De-Wei (Quantitive Geography, Geographical Information System), Chen Chuan-Kang (Geography of Tourism, Dietetic Cultural Geography), Yang Kai-Zhong (Regional Research), Wang En-Yong (Cultural Geography, Political Geography).
